Our onsite Program Management team in Chicago, IL is looking to add an experienced and collaborative Project Manager in support of an airport capital Redevelopment Program at Midway Airport. The redevelopment will occur in the middle of an active airport and the existing terminals, runways and taxiways will remain operational while the new facilities are built in a phased approach. This position allows for the opportunity to be a major contributor to the growth of Miday as part of the program management team.
Reporting to the Utility Coordination Manager, you will be responsible for leading projects and utility activities with a team of utility project managers, engineers, and CAD technicians while managing subconsultants who provide aviation, IT, utilities, and telecommunications support. You will oversee master planning, design coordination, base mapping, construction sequencing, and commissioning of utilities, verifying alignment with airport operations. The role includes engaging with airport contractors and stakeholders to identify utility locations and routing, and coordinating with FAA, ComEd, Peoples Gas, Telecom, and other third-party utilities to address scoping, scheduling, budgeting, and compliance matters. This position will be responsible for maintaining a utility tracker to document meeting minutes, invoices, exhibits, utility records, utility design documents etc. You will work closely with the project managers, designers, construction managers, to support utility related design/specification and construction efforts, while also assessing site utilities across all Midway projects. You will also be required to conduct monthly utility workshops for all CDA owned and third-party utilities, assist the CDA Utility Group/CDA Facilities in identifying ageing infrastructures, gaps in infrastructure reliability, and create a wish list of future capital projects. In this role, you will provide strategic guidance to senior leadership on utility policies and major decisions.
